Rembrandt’s Night Watch Dog Origin Revealed

TL;DR Summary
Experts suggest that Rembrandt's painting The Night Watch features a dog copied from a lesser-known Dutch artist's work, highlighting the common practice of emulation in the Dutch Golden Age rather than plagiarism, with the source identified as a drawing by Adriaen van de Venne.
